BLS metro-level wage data places Licensed Practical and Licensed Vocational Nurses pay in Salinas, CA at a median of $80,910 per year ($38.90/hr/hour), drawn from the OEWS May 2025 release for this Metropolitan Statistical Area. Compared to the national median of $64,400, Salinas pays +26% above, signaling either concentrated employer demand, a cost-of-living premium, or both. Approximately 710 licensed practical and licensed vocational nursess are employed across the Salinas MSA in SOC 29-2061.

The Salinas pay distribution spans from $64,340 at the 10th percentile to $96,370 at the 90th — a 1.5× spread that reflects experience tenure, specialization, employer size, and the difference between public-sector, nonprofit, and private-sector compensation inside the metro. The 25th percentile sits at $74,870 and the 75th at $91,520, so half of Salinas-based licensed practical and licensed vocational nursess earn within that middle band.

Metro figures capture where you actually work, not just where you live — which matters for commuters. BLS draws metro boundaries from the OMB MSA definitions, so Salinas, CA covers the central city plus outlying counties tied to the metro economically. Remember that OEWS wages reflect base pay only: employer-provided health insurance, retirement matches, stock options, signing bonuses, overtime, and tips are excluded and can add 20-40% to real total compensation. Before using this metro median as a negotiation anchor, triangulate against the same occupation's national profile (linked below), its state-wide CA data, and peer-metro comparisons — a median is a starting point, not a ceiling.
